Step 1

Friedel-Crafts reaction in organic chemistry is a reaction in which the aromatic proton is replaced by an alkyl group. The replacement is done by the electrophilic attack of the carbocation on the aromatic ring. The reagents used for the electrophilic attack is AlCl3 or FeCl3 as a catalyst and an alkyl chloride. The catalyst act as lewis acid.

Step 2

The given reaction is a Friedel- Crafts alkylation reaction. The mechanism for the given reaction can be shown in the following steps:

(1) The catalyst, AlCl3 acting as lewis acid, reacts with the alkyl halide to give an electrophilic carbocation.
